Rexhen interviews Vanessa Jackson, founder of Phoenix Rising Coaching and Teachers in Transition. Vanessa specializes in helping burned-out educators transition to new careers without starting over, drawing on her 25 years in education and staffing expertise.

Vanessa shares her journey of acquiring the "Teachers in Transition" business and learning coaching and business skills on the fly. Her client acquisition relies heavily on word-of-mouth referrals and free resume workshops, which she promotes via her newsletter and Facebook groups.

She plans to develop a DIY course and expand her online presence to platforms like Substack and Blue Sky. Key investments include Coaches Console for business management and Corporate Communications for social media. Vanessa emphasizes the importance of understanding "the art of the close" and offering guarantees to build trust.

Her biggest challenges are consistent client acquisition and helping teachers process trauma from their past roles. She asserts that teachers possess versatile skills for many careers, and stresses networking in the current AI-driven job market.

Vanessa's advice: invest in your education, believe in yourself, and seek guidance on necessary tools.
